LIGA International (The Flying Doctors of Mercy) is a non-profit organization that provides free health care and education to the people of Sinaloa Mexico, since 1934. LIGA Pilots are a critical to the completion of our mission. Our Pilots and their planes allow LIGA to transport the Medical Staff and support Volunteers to our clinic in Sinaloa Mexico in a timely manner. Without you we would not be able to provide these services on a monthly basis.

We provide an opportunity for our LIGA Pilot Volunteers to safely fly into Mexico in a coordinated group, to some unique destinations and spend quality time with like minded Pilots and Medical Volunteers. We fly to 3 clinic locations in Mexico and also organize several day trips for our volunteers (Copper Canyon, Baja Whales Trip etc). Liga Pilot Profile
  • Instrument rated w/ more than 400 hours total time.
  • or VFR Pilot w/ more than 600 hours total time
  • US & Mexico Flight Insurance (Min: $1,000,000/$500,000)
  • Add liga as Additional Insurance to your policy
  • Complete & Sign Pilot Certification, Volunteer & Pilot Waivers
  • Establish an eAPIS Account and Complete your eAPIS Profile
  • Mexico Flight Experience Not Required - We will show you how!
